Output 62e3fe92c38868ccffdb76ff6bc319bbe46a6df5ea105b70072d042b5dd8c059:43

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f1987774e7086c879dde58b6519d8825b2f39a5 OP_EQUAL
address
3AMrhZj9hSMvRB7DA9LQEystPstnuz4NJT
transaction
62e3fe92c38868ccffdb76ff6bc319bbe46a6df5ea105b70072d042b5dd8c059
spent
true